In this overview, the LiFePO4 Battery Charger Qoltec 52670 is compared with similar chargers, balancers, and controllers from the same manufacturer, Qoltec. All reviewed models are designed to work with lithium iron phosphate (LiFePO4) batteries and energy storage systems, but they differ in power, current rating, functionality, and purpose — ranging from standard battery charging to voltage balancing and solar power management.
⚙️ Below is a comparison of technical specifications, including output voltage, current rating, power capacity, supported charging technologies, and the primary purpose of each device.
| Parameter | Qoltec 52670 (Main model) | Qoltec 52672 | Qoltec 52671 | Qoltec with crocodile clips | Qoltec 48V balancer | Qoltec MPPT controller | Practical significance of differences |
|---|
| Device type | LiFePO4 battery charger | LiFePO4 battery charger | LiFePO4 battery charger | Automotive/industrial charger | Battery voltage balancer | MPPT solar charge controller | Determines the core role of the device in a power system. |
| Output current | 10A | 30A | 20A | 10A | 10A (equalization) | 10A | Affects how quickly battery capacity can be restored. |
| Power | 150W | 438W | 292W | Not specified | Not applicable | Not applicable (12V/24V) | Higher power allows faster recharging of larger capacity batteries. |
| Charging technology | CC/CV | CC/CV | CC/CV | Standard | Not applicable (balancing) | MPPT | Ensures a safe charging algorithm or maximum energy harvest from panels. |
◎ The table below evaluates how well each product matches different usage scenarios, power requirements, and energy system tasks.
| Usage scenario | Recommended product | Why it is most suitable |
|---|
| Charging standard medium-capacity LiFePO4 batteries | LiFePO4 Battery Charger Qoltec 52670 | Provides an optimal 10A current and 150W power for safe battery maintenance without paying extra for excessive capacity. |
| Fast charging of heavy-duty, high-capacity batteries | Qoltec 52672 | Delivers a maximum power of 438W and 30A current for efficient handling of large energy storage banks. |
| Maintenance of medium-capacity batteries with reduced charge time | Qoltec 52671 | Offers an intermediate power of 292W and 20A current, serving as a balanced choice between the base and max model. |
| Automotive or general battery maintenance tasks | Qoltec Battery Charger 10A with Crocodile Clips | Equipped with convenient crocodile clips for quick and secure connection in automotive or workshop environments. |
| Charge equalization in multi-battery series configurations | Qoltec 48V Battery Voltage Balancer | Specifically built to prevent premature degradation and equalize voltage across 48V battery banks. |
| Off-grid solar systems and mobile power setups | Qoltec MPPT Solar Charge Controller | Integrates an MPPT controller, supports solar panels, features an LCD screen and dual USB ports for device power in remote locations. |
